Vie de la Princesse Borghese, nee Guendaline Talbot, Comtesse de Shewsbury/ par A. Zeloni.

Saved in:
Bibliographic Details
Main Author: Zeloni, A.
Other Associated Names: Bellew, George, binder
Language:French
Published: Paris Aug. Vaton 1843
Subjects:
Talbot, Guendaline, Princess Borgése, 1817- Biography
french
Collection:Benjamin Iveagh
